3Com EtherLink Plus
Required entry:
• drivername = elnkpl$ or elnkpln$
The following table summarizes the possible entries and values in the
[elnkpl] section of the LAN Manager PROTOCOL.INI file:
Entry Units Range Default
datatransfer — — DMA
dmachannel integer 1, 3, or 5–7 1
drivername — — elnkpl$ or
elnkpln$
interrupt integer 3–15 3
ioaddress hex. 300–3F0 300
maxtransmits integer 8–50 23
netaddress hex. 12 hex. digits —
Entries in the [elnkpl] section of the LAN Manager PROTOCOL.INI file
have the following meanings:
datatransfer
Specifies the data transfer mode for the network adapter, according to
DMA, PIO_WORD, or PIO_BYTE values.
dmachannel
Indicates the current DMA jumper configuration of the network
adapter. The value can be 1, 3, or 5–7.
drivername
Identifies the device driver name. The drivername is elnkpl$ for the
first adapter, elnkpl2$ for the second, and so on.
interrupt
Indicates the interrupt level of the network adapter.
ioaddress
Identifies the I/O base address.
maxtransmits
Specifies the number of transmit queue entries in this driver. For an
OS/2 server, multiply the transmit window size by the maximum
number of sessions.
